How To Fix /SMB/SOL_COMP020 - Automatic Transport Not Supported


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SMB/SOL_COMP -

  • Message number: 020

  • Message text: Automatic Transport Not Supported

    The SAP error message /SMB/SOL_COMP020 Automatic Transport Not Supported typically occurs in the context of SAP Solution Manager or when dealing with transport requests in the SAP system. This error indicates that the system is unable to automatically transport certain components or objects due to configuration or compatibility issues.

    Cause:

    1. Unsupported Components: The component or object you are trying to transport may not support automatic transport. This can happen if the component is not designed to be transported automatically or if it is not compatible with the transport mechanism in use.

    2. Configuration Issues: There may be configuration settings in the SAP system that prevent automatic transport for certain types of objects or components.

    3. Transport Layer Issues: The transport layer may not be correctly set up, or the transport routes may not be defined properly.

    4. Version Compatibility: The version of the component you are trying to transport may not be compatible with the version of the target system.

    Solution:

    1. Manual Transport: If automatic transport is not supported, consider performing a manual transport of the component or object. This may involve creating a transport request manually and then importing it into the target system.

    2.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ings in the SAP system to ensure that automatic transport is enabled for the components you are working with. This may involve checking the transport routes and layers.

    3. Update Components: Ensure that all components are up to date and compatible with the target system. If necessary, update the components to a version that supports automatic transport.

    4.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ation or notes related to the specific component or object you are trying to transport. There may be specific guidelines or limitations regarding transport.

    5. SAP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ance. They may provide additional insights or solutions based on the specific context of your system.
